## Releases

Welcome aboard! Quieten, our on-call alert deduplicator, ships every other Thursday. We cut a tag from main, run the smoke suite against the Farwick staging cluster, and push artifacts to the internal registry. If you're doing the release, ping whoever's on rotation first — usually Marla or Deet — so nobody double-cuts. Hotfixes skip the schedule but still need a signed build; unsigned tarballs get rejected at deploy time, no exceptions. To verify any release artifact locally, use the current signing key below.

signing key of yagug-bawif = bky9_cvCf6ehGp

## Deployment

This service now builds under Stonemill, our hermetic build system, replacing the ad-hoc shell scripts previously used. All dependencies are pinned in the lockfile and fetched from the internal mirror; network access during builds is disabled. Deploys consume only the sealed artifact produced by Stonemill — do not deploy from a local workspace. Maintainers should keep the build manifest and the runtime settings in sync. The current deployment configuration values are listed below.

service settings:
novath:
  pin: 1396
  tenant: pelys
  seal: seal_ccc035e1
  metrics_host: metrics.novath.qorvelworks.test
  standby_team: fraeth
  escalation: drueth-zorok
  nonce: 61d508

Ticket: Unlock migration vault for Ironvine ORM refactor

New team members: the legacy Ironvine ORM layer is being replaced module by module, and the schema snapshots needed for safe refactoring sit in a locked vault nobody has opened since the last owner left. We recovered the credentials from escrow this week. The passphrase follows below.

unlock words, kajog-yawip: istwyn-casath-aldok

### Runbook: Planner regression in Quenchly

So you've hit the query planner regression again. Symptoms: the nightly rollup jobs on Quenchly suddenly take 40+ minutes instead of 3, and the plan flips from an index scan to a full table walk. This happens when stats go stale after the big weekly purge — don't panic, it's not data corruption. First, refresh statistics on the rollup tables and re-run one job to confirm the plan flips back. If it doesn't, pin the planner using the override settings below:

deployment values, yadug-bawif:
[framir]
team = pelox
access_code = ac_a38ab2
owner = tamion.julael
host = framir.tolvaqlabs.test
port = 11211
peer = tammir.zemvargrid.local
salt = 2215ef03
pin = 1541